K132192 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the BRACCO DIAGNOSTICS INC. PROTOCO, L TOUCH COLON INSUFFLATOR. Classified as Insufflator, Automatic Carbon-dioxide For Endoscope (product code FCX),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Bracco Diagnostic, Inc. (Monroe Township,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on February 14, 2014 after a review of 214 days - an extended review cycle.

This device falls under the Gastroenterology & Urology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 876.1500 - the FDA gastroenterology and urology device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
